我们使用Python内置的open()函数来创建一个文件对象,然后使用write()方法将JSON字符串写入文件中。 withopen('students.json','w')asf:f.write(json_str) 1. 2. 上述代码中,'students.json’是我们要创建的JSON文件的文件名。使用’w’参数表示以写入模式打开文件。 总结 通过以上四个
使用json.dumps()函数将List数据序列化为JSON格式的字符串。 json_data=json.dumps(students) 1. 4. 将JSON数据保存到文件中 接下来,我们将序列化后的JSON数据保存到一个文件中。可以使用open()函数打开一个文件,并将JSON数据写入文件中。 withopen("students.json","w")asfile:file.write(json_data) 1. 2...
data_list = [1, 2, 3, "hello", {"key": "value"}] 使用json模块的dump方法将list保存为json文件: 使用json.dump()方法可以将Python对象(如list)直接写入文件,并保存为JSON格式。这个方法比json.dumps()方法更方便,因为json.dumps()只是将对象转换为JSON格式的字符串,而json.dump()则可以直接将对象写...
json 格式 字符串 与 Python 中的 字典 dict 和 列表 list 变量 可以无缝转换 ; 调用json.dumps 函数 可以将 Python 列表/ 字典 转为 json ; 调用json.loads 函数 ,可以将 json 转为 python 列表 / 字典 ; 一、json 格式转换 1、json 模块使用 首先 , 导入 Python 内置的 json 模块 ; 代码语言:javasc...
str_json = json.dumps(list_json, indent=4, ensure_ascii=False) return str_json """ dict类型 转 json文件 """ def dict_To_Json(dictObj): js_obj = json.dumps(dictObj, indent=4,ensure_ascii=False) file_object = open('./Param/devs_config.ini', 'w') ...
PythonJSON str,unicode string int,long,float number True true False false None null dict object list,tuple array (3)其他常用参数说明 dumps(obj, , skipkeys=False, ensure_ascii=True, check_circular=True, allow_nan=True, cls=None, indent=None, separators=None, default=None, sort_keys=False,...
Python作为最近几年火爆的编程语言之一,有不同的学习方向,针对这些小猿圈Python讲师每天为大家分享一个知识点,今天分享的就是Python使用zip将list转为json的方法,希望对你的学习有所帮助。 zip()函数将可迭代对象作为参数,并打包成元组,返回的是一个个zip对象,可以使用list或dict转换返回结果,使用*zip可以将打包的对象...
json读写: importjson'''#写入 dump listStr = [{"city": "北京"}, {"name": "⼤刘"}] json.dump(listStr, open("listStr.json","w"), ensure_ascii=False) dictStr = {"city": "北京", "name": "⼤刘"} json.dump(dictStr, open("dictStr.json","w"), ensure_ascii=False)'''...
def json_parse(df): for i in df.keys(): if type(df[i][0])==dict and df[i][0]!={}: df=json_to_columns(df,i) #调用上面的函数 return df ### 处理值类型为list的列,转换为dict def list_parse(df): for i in df.keys(): ...
下面是将一个简单的列表保存到JSON文件的步骤: 引入json模块。 创建一个列表。 使用json.dump()将列表写入文件。 示例代码 以下示例代码演示了如何将Python列表保存到JSON文件中: importjson# 创建一个简单的列表my_list=['apple','banana','cherry','date']# 将列表保存到JSON文件withopen('my_list.json','...